legongju.com
我们一直在努力
2025-01-12 07:02 | 星期天

php nosql优势怎么发挥

PHP NoSQL 优势可以通过以下几个方面来发挥:

  1. 高性能:NoSQL 数据库通常具有高性能的数据读写能力,特别是在处理大量非结构化数据时。在 PHP 中使用 NoSQL 数据库可以大幅提高应用程序的响应速度和吞吐量。

  2. 灵活的数据模型:NoSQL 数据库通常提供文档、键值、列族和图形等多种数据模型,这使得开发者可以根据应用需求选择最适合的数据模型。在 PHP 中,你可以利用这些不同的数据模型来存储和操作不同类型的数据,提高代码的可维护性和可扩展性。

  3. 水平扩展性:NoSQL 数据库设计为易于横向扩展,可以通过分片、副本集和集群等方式实现数据的分布式存储和处理。在 PHP 中,你可以利用 NoSQL 数据库的扩展性来应对不断增长的数据量和访问量,保证应用程序的稳定性和可用性。

  4. 更好的支持非结构化数据:NoSQL 数据库通常对非结构化数据有很好的支持,如 JSON、XML 等格式的数据。在 PHP 中,你可以直接将非结构化数据存储在 NoSQL 数据库中,并通过简单的查询操作获取和处理这些数据,提高开发效率。

  5. 简化应用开发:使用 NoSQL 数据库可以减少应用程序的复杂性,特别是在处理复杂的数据关系和查询时。在 PHP 中,你可以使用简单的 API 来操作 NoSQL 数据库,无需编写复杂的 SQL 查询语句,降低开发难度。

要充分发挥 PHP NoSQL 的优势,你需要根据应用需求选择合适的 NoSQL 数据库(如 MongoDB、Redis、Couchbase 等),并熟悉 PHP 中对应的 NoSQL 扩展和库(如 MongoDB 的 PHP 扩展、Redis 的 PHP 扩展等)。在实际开发中,合理地使用 NoSQL 数据库可以带来更好的性能、可扩展性和易用性。

未经允许不得转载 » 本文链接:https://www.legongju.com/article/76841.html

相关推荐

  • PHP中number_format()函数的参数含义及用法

    PHP中number_format()函数的参数含义及用法

    number_format() 是 PHP 中的一个内置函数,用于格式化数字为千位分隔的字符串。这在显示货币、统计数据等场景中非常有用。
    number_format() 函数接受四个参...

  • 如何自定义number_format()函数的千位分隔符

    如何自定义number_format()函数的千位分隔符

    要自定义number_format()函数的千位分隔符,您需要在调用该函数时提供第四个参数
    number_format(float $number, int $decimals = 0, string $decimal_separ...

  • number_format()函数在PHP中的进制转换功能

    number_format()函数在PHP中的进制转换功能

    number_format() 函数在 PHP 中用于对数字进行格式化
    以下是一个使用 number_format() 函数将十进制数转换为其他进制的示例: 输出结果:
    原始十进制数...

  • PHP number_format()函数处理千位分隔符的方法

    PHP number_format()函数处理千位分隔符的方法

    number_format() 是 PHP 中用于格式化数字的一个内置函数,它可以方便地添加千位分隔符(也称为千分位符)
    这里有一个简单的示例: 在这个例子中,我们使用...

  • php nosql数据怎样备份

    php nosql数据怎样备份

    要备份PHP和NoSQL(如MongoDB)的数据,您可以使用以下方法: 使用mongodump工具备份MongoDB数据:
    mongodump是MongoDB自带的备份工具,可以将数据库中的数...

  • php nosql数据库如何选型

    php nosql数据库如何选型

    在选择PHP NoSQL数据库时,需要考虑以下几个因素: 数据类型和结构:根据你的数据类型和结构来选择适合的NoSQL数据库。例如,如果你的数据是键值对或者文档形式,...

  • php nosql存储方案如何定

    php nosql存储方案如何定

    在为PHP项目选择NoSQL存储方案时,需要考虑以下几个因素: 数据结构:首先,你需要了解你的数据结构。NoSQL数据库通常用于处理非结构化或半结构化数据,如文档、...

  • php nosql数据如何迁移

    php nosql数据如何迁移

    在PHP中迁移NoSQL数据通常涉及到从一个数据库或存储系统导出数据,然后将其导入到另一个NoSQL数据库中。以下是一个通用的步骤指南,帮助你完成这个过程:
    1...